Clinical Trial

A Cancer Vaccine (STEMVAC) in Combination With Chemotherapy for the Treatment of PD-L1 Negative Metastatic Triple-Negative Breast Cancer

Recruiting Phase 2
View on ClinicalTrials.gov →
Summary
This phase II trial studies how well a cancer vaccine called STEMVAC works in combination with chemotherapy in treating patients with PD-L1 negative, triple-negative breast cancer that has spread from where it first started (primary site) to other places in the body (metastatic). STEMVAC is designed to target proteins that are expressed on breast cancer stem cells, and it is believed to work by boosting the immune system to recognize and destroy the invader tumor cells that are causing the disease. Chemotherapy drugs work in different ways to stop the growth of tumor cells, either by killing the cells, by stopping them from dividing, or by stopping them from spreading. Giving STEMVAC in combination with chemotherapy may be an effective treatment for PD-L1 negative metastatic triple-negative breast cancer.
